验证服务器端信息失败原因,深入剖析数字证书验证失败,原因与应对策略详解
- 综合资讯
- 2024-11-18 17:08:40
- 1

深入解析数字证书验证失败原因,剖析问题根源,并提出有效应对策略,确保服务器端信息验证顺利进行。...
深入解析数字证书验证失败原因,剖析问题根源,并提出有效应对策略,确保服务器端信息验证顺利进行。
随着互联网技术的飞速发展,网络安全问题日益凸显,在众多网络安全技术中,数字证书作为一种重要的安全手段,被广泛应用于各个领域,在实际应用过程中,数字证书验证失败的问题时有发生,严重影响了用户体验,本文将从数字证书验证失败的原因入手,深入剖析问题根源,并提出相应的应对策略。
数字证书验证失败的原因
1、证书过期
数字证书具有有效期,一旦证书过期,服务器端将无法通过验证,导致客户端无法访问,证书过期可能是由于管理员忘记续费,也可能是证书颁发机构未能及时更新证书信息。
2、证书颁发机构问题
证书颁发机构(CA)是数字证书的权威机构,负责颁发、管理和撤销数字证书,若证书颁发机构存在问题,如证书颁发流程不规范、证书信息错误等,将导致证书验证失败。
3、证书链不完整
数字证书采用链式结构,由根证书、中间证书和叶证书组成,若证书链不完整,客户端将无法验证证书的有效性,导致验证失败。
4、证书格式错误
数字证书格式错误可能导致客户端无法识别证书信息,从而无法完成验证,常见的证书格式错误包括:证书类型错误、加密算法错误等。
5、服务器配置问题
服务器配置不当也可能导致数字证书验证失败,服务器未启用SSL/TLS协议、SSL/TLS版本过低、证书路径错误等。
6、客户端问题
客户端配置不当或软件故障也可能导致数字证书验证失败,浏览器未正确安装CA根证书、客户端软件版本过低等。
应对策略
1、定期检查证书有效期
管理员应定期检查数字证书的有效期,确保证书在有效期内,一旦发现证书过期,应及时办理续费手续。
2、加强证书颁发机构管理
证书颁发机构应严格遵守相关规范,确保证书颁发流程的规范性和准确性,定期对证书信息进行审核,确保证书信息的真实性。
3、完善证书链
确保证书链完整,包括根证书、中间证书和叶证书,在部署数字证书时,仔细核对证书链,避免证书链不完整导致验证失败。
4、优化证书格式
确保数字证书格式正确,包括证书类型、加密算法等,在证书生成过程中,严格遵循相关规范,避免证书格式错误。
5、优化服务器配置
确保服务器配置正确,包括启用SSL/TLS协议、选择合适的SSL/TLS版本、设置正确的证书路径等,定期检查服务器配置,确保其符合安全要求。
6、加强客户端管理
确保客户端软件版本最新,并正确安装CA根证书,定期检查客户端配置,避免因客户端问题导致数字证书验证失败。
7、增强应急处理能力
当数字证书验证失败时,应迅速定位问题原因,并采取相应措施解决,通知用户重新连接、联系证书颁发机构协助解决问题等。
8、建立安全监控体系
建立健全安全监控体系,实时监控数字证书验证情况,一旦发现异常,及时采取措施,防止问题扩大。
数字证书验证失败是一个复杂的问题,涉及多个方面,通过深入剖析问题原因,我们可以采取针对性的应对策略,提高数字证书验证的可靠性,在今后的工作中,我们要不断总结经验,加强网络安全管理,为用户提供安全、稳定的网络环境。
本文链接:https://www.zhitaoyun.cn/924254.html
发表评论